Superintendent’s data director outlines mixed PSSA/Keystone results; district emphasizes growth and curriculum changes
Summary
Dr. Myers presented district PSSA and Keystone data showing middle-school growth and mixed high-school results affected by COVID-era testing shifts; the district will focus on targeted interventions, curriculum changes for math and science, and additional retesting opportunities.
Dr. Myers presented the district’s PSSA and Keystone performance during the Jan. 13 caucus, framing the results as a snapshot that shows both growth and areas needing attention. She said elementary and middle grades showed notable growth in many subjects, while some high-school Keystone results reflected the lingering effects of COVID-era testing schedules and a change in the grade at which students take trigger courses.
